John E. Clark has been admitted in 1961, Texas; 1965, U.S. District Court, Western District of Texas; 1971, U.S. Supreme Court; 1975, U.S. District Court, Northern District of Texas; 1977, U.S. District Court, Eastern and Southern Districts of Texas; 1982, U.S. Court of Appeals, Fifth Circuit; 1998, U.S. Court of Appeals, Third Circuit. His or her practice areas include Federal and State "Whistleblower" (Qui Tam/False Claims Act) Litigation.
John E. Clark's college and law school education includes Lamar University, B.S., 1954, University of Texas, LL.B., 1961. Other biographical background includes Phi Alpha Delta. Author, "The Fall of the Duke of Duval," Eakin Press, 1995. Trial Attorney, U.S. Department of Justice, Washington, DC, 1969-1971. First Assistant U.S. Attorney, 1971-1975 and U.S. Attorney, 1975-1977, Western District of Texas. Justice, Fourth Court of Appeals, 1981-1982. Member, 1983-1994 and Chairman, 1989-1991, National Institute of Corrections Advisory Board. Member, Texas Commission on Law Enforcement Officer Standards and Education, 1987-1994. Member, 1993-2000 and Chairman, 1998-1999, Texas Ethics Commission. Fellow: Texas Bar Foundation; San Antonio Bar Foundation.. You should contact other
